If the symbol x denotes \"added to\", the symbol ÷ denotes \"subtracted from\", the symbol + denotes \"divided by\" and the symbol – denotes \"multiplied by\", then what is the value of 14 x 12 – 16 ÷ 18 under these redefined operations?

Difficulty: Easy

Correct Answer: 188

Explanation:


Introduction / Context:
This is a classic operator-replacement question. The symbols x, ÷, +, and – no longer carry their usual arithmetic meanings. Instead, each symbol represents a different basic operation. We must carefully substitute the correct operations and then evaluate the expression using normal arithmetic precedence.


Given Data / Assumptions:

  • x means \"added to\" (ordinary addition).
  • ÷ means \"subtracted from\" (ordinary subtraction).
  • + means \"divided by\" (ordinary division).
  • – means \"multiplied by\" (ordinary multiplication).
  • Expression: 14 x 12 – 16 ÷ 18.


Concept / Approach:
We translate each symbol into the operation it represents and then evaluate the resulting expression with standard precedence rules: multiplication and division first, then addition and subtraction, working from left to right as needed.


Step-by-Step Solution:
Step 1: Replace each symbol with its real meaning. x → +, – → ×, ÷ → −, + → ÷ (not used here). So 14 x 12 – 16 ÷ 18 becomes: 14 + 12 × 16 − 18. Step 2: Apply normal precedence: do the multiplication first. 12 × 16 = 192. Step 3: Now compute the remaining operations from left to right. 14 + 192 − 18. 14 + 192 = 206. 206 − 18 = 188.


Verification / Alternative check:
We can confirm there is only one multiplication and one subtraction. No hidden parentheses are implied, so performing multiplication before addition and subtraction is correct. Rechecking the symbol meanings shows we substituted each correctly, so 188 is reliable.


Why Other Options Are Wrong:
Values like 430, 180, and 168 would arise only if we misread one or more symbols (for example, treating x as multiplication or ÷ as division) or ignored precedence rules. Because the entire point of the question is the redefinition of operators, such interpretations are invalid.



Common Pitfalls:
The most common mistake is to mechanically apply the usual meaning of the symbols rather than the new meanings. Another pitfall is to evaluate from left to right without respecting multiplication precedence, which also gives an incorrect result.



Final Answer:
Under the redefined operations, the expression 14 x 12 – 16 ÷ 18 evaluates to 188.
